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48177928 44 232935 2421
89884478 676
89884478 676
293 12084536598 535 088460 27
All about undefined
Interested in learning more?
89884478 676
293 12084536598 535 088460 27
See more
767822 548
306865142 06827 9275
See more
85 02560 47094657
1933078 8969512 73506495
See more